Handpicked from old, gnarly bush vines planted in 1889 in two acres of deep sandy loam soil over red-brown clay in the heart of the Barossa Valley. Year after year these ancestor vines give small quantities of exceptional grapes.
Tasting Note Striking floral aromas, complex and intriguing. Blueberry, wild cherry, raspberries and pomegranates are entwined in orange zest, pepper, spices and leafy notes. The hallmark of this wine is 249 day post-ferment maceration which imparts incredible silky texture and refinement to the palate, creating a textural wine with depth, structure, vibrant acidity and defined tannins. Stunning now, it will gradually evolve over the medium term.
